Start documenting his problems now. Write down everything because it may become useful later when you go to court. For instance "Took the kids to school this morning, hubby too wasted on meth" and "Hubby yelled at the kids and I today because he was high and they were making too much noise and he wanted to sleep" Stuff like that. You'd be surprised how far those kinds of things can go in court.

jmargel and Mz Pixie are both right- see a lawyer, and write everyhing down and start telling everyone (Doctors, priests, teachers, work collegues, hairdresser, childcare etc everyone!) what's happening, don't keep his behaviour a secret- if you do you're protecting him and making it harder for yourself.

 

If you feel physically unsafe you may wish to contact your nearest domestic violence shelter to get some advice about safety plans. He is clearly emotionally abusive (ie threats to kill himself) and you need to protect yourself and your child in case of escalation of his behaviour, especially because he is on meth and that turns people into violent, smelly, f**kheads anyway (at one job I worked in we used to say we'd rather deal with the heroin addicts than the meth heads anytime) .

 

I don't know about your part of the world but down here? him getting residency? Wouldn't happen if you've got all your evidence lined up- you are your child's primary carer and don't have a drug problem. He'd be lucky to get supervised access (ie he can see the child but only in the presence of a third party and never alone). See a lawyer!
